Minnesota Gov. Tim Walz is working on a book inspired in part by the massive immigration enforcement surge in the Minneapolis-St. Paul area earlier this year and by the extensive pushback of local residents.

“Good Neighbors” will be published next year, W.W. Norton & Company told The Associated Press on Wednesday.
